Startup Hustle is a 12-week bootcamp designed to help prepare you to launch a new startup. Be prepared to stretch your ideas with insights that can lead to remarkable breakthroughs. We’ll introduce tools, perspectives, and connections to help you succeed.

In this course, we show you step-by-step how to identify your customer and their needs. Then, we investigate their problems. Based on evidence that we collect by talking with them and field testing, we develop and the Value Proposition that you’ll use to start your business.

The bootcamp will enable participants to use the latest startup tools, work on their ideas, test them with customers, gain insights from mentors, research the market, reframe their concept based on what they learn, and develop a pitch. Startup Hustle includes a Demo Night where participants make their pitches to the community.
